•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

macro kolom invoegen op aantal werkbladen

Status
Niet open voor verdere reacties.

alegandro

Gebruiker
Lid geworden
29 feb 2008
Berichten
32
Dit is echt mijn allerlaatste vraag.........

Ik heb een werkmap met 14 werkbladen voor de weeknummers en één werkblad voor het eindtotaal.
Op elk werkblad staan bovenaan filiaal nummers. nou wil ik met één klik op de knop in het werkblad eindtotaal een filiaal kunnen toevoegen. Hij voegt dan een kolom in voor de kolom met filiaal 2001. en hij moet de reeksen doorvoeren die links van hem staan.
hij dient de kolom niet alleen toe te voegen in eindtotaal, maar ook bij alle weeknummers.

Ik heb nu deze macro. deze voert heel netjes een kolom in op de plaats waar ik wil, maar hij voert de reeksen niet door in de kolom links van hem en op deze manier zou ik bij elk weeknummer deze macro moeten afspelen.

Sub kolominvoegen()
Range("nederland").Select
Selection.Insert Shift:=xlToRight
End Sub

verder dan bovenstaande formule kwam ik echter niet. dus zou iemand mij een laatste maal willen assisteren...??

mijn dank is bij voorbaat al groot.
gr Alex
 
Ik ben er zelf nog niet echt verder mee gekomen. het lukt me aldoor maar niet.
voor de macro toe te passen op 1 werkblad lukt me nog wel, maar vooral het toepassen op meerdere werkbladen tegelijkertijd is erg lastig.

bitte sehr iemand??
 
Hallo,

Kan je een voorbeeld sturen? Liefst zippen.
Als ik het zo lees is het geen "rocket science".

Met vriendelijke groet,


Roncancio
 
De nederlandse filialen beginnen met een 1, dus 1001 t/m 1179.
Als ik een nederlands filiaal wil toevoegen. op het moment 1180 dan moet deze dus altijd links van het filiaal 2001 geplaatst worden.
een belgisch filiaal moet altijd geplaatst worden achter het laatste belgische filiaal. dus op dit moment 2012.
Wat ik wil; als je op de macro knop nederlands filaal toevoegen dat hij in alle werkbladen met weeknummers en het werkblad 'subtotaal' een kolom invoegt en dan de kolom links van hem doorvoert in de nieuwe kolom. dus dat alle formules doorlopend gecopieerd worden.
Ditzelfde wil ik voor de macro knop belgisch filiaal toevoegen.
Ik weet dat het niet helemaall een technisch hoogstaand vraagje is, maar ik kwam niet verder dan een kolom invoegen op één werkblad.
alvast bedankt,
Alex
 

Bijlagen

Is het toevallig al gelukt?? of is het niet helemaal duidelijk wat ik bedoel?
ik ben er zelf maar mee gestopt, want 'k kom er echt niet uit.:confused:
 
Hallo,

Het duurde even omdat ik het nogal druk had.

In het bestand heb ik 2 macro's gemaakt.
- toevoegen van een Nederlands bedrijf
- toevoegen van een Belgisch bedrijf.

Voor beiden geldt:
- Er wordt een kolom toegevoegd
- De toegevoegde kolom krijgt een oplopende nummer (voor Nederlandse filialen 1180, 1181 etc.)
- De verwijzingen en formules van de kolom ernaast worden overgenomen in de nieuwe kolom.

Met vriendelijke groet,


Roncancio
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an